This is Mingus's 13th studio album, but his first for a major label: Columbia. And a really good one. "Ah hum is not only considered his best work (along with The Black Saint and the Sinner Lady), but also one of the most important jazz albums in history. With an unusual line-up of three saxophones, two trombones and a rhythm section of bass, drums and piano, the set was recorded in just two days. Some tracks became standards, such as the opening "Better Git it in Your Soul", "Fables of Faubus" or "Goodbye Pork Pie Hat", a tribute to the recently deceased Lester Young.
